What is a linear function?

Back

A linear function is a function that can be graphically represented as a straight line. It has a constant rate of change and can be expressed in the form y = mx + b, where m is the slope and b is the y-intercept.

What is a non-linear function?

Back

A non-linear function is a function that does not create a straight line when graphed. It can have curves, bends, or other shapes, and its rate of change is not constant.

How can you identify a linear function from a graph?

Back

A linear function can be identified by a straight line on the graph. If the graph curves or bends, it is not a linear function.

What does it mean if a graph is not a function?

Back

A graph is not a function if any vertical line drawn through the graph intersects it at more than one point. This violates the definition of a function, which states that each input must have exactly one output.

What is the slope of a linear function?

Back

The slope of a linear function is a measure of its steepness, represented by 'm' in the equation y = mx + b. It indicates how much y changes for a unit change in x.

What is the y-intercept of a linear function?

Back

The y-intercept is the point where the graph of a function crosses the y-axis. It is represented by 'b' in the equation y = mx + b.
